NZM

Basic devices

Circuit-breakers

1

Rated uninterrupted current up to

1600 A

Switching capacity 25, 36, 50, 150 kA

at 415 V

Adjustable releases for overload

and short-circuit

Adjustable time selectivity

Protection of systems, cables,

motors, generators

3 and 4 pole; IEC/EN 60947

→Page 17/8

Switch-disconnectors

1

Rated uninterrupted current up

to 1600 A

Can be tripped remotely with

undervoltage or shunt release

3 and 4 pole; IEC/EN 60947

→Page 17/42

Circuit-breakers for

North America

1

Rated uninterrupted current up

to 1200 A

Switching capacity 25, 35,

100 kA at 480 V

Adjustable release for

overload and short-circuit

Adjustable time selectivity

Protection of systems, cables,

motors, generators

3 and 4 pole, UL 489/CSA 22.2

no. 5.1, IEC/EN 60947

→Page 17/54

Molded case switches for

North America

1

Rated uninterrupted current up

to 1200 A

Can be tripped remotely with

undervoltage or shunt release

3 pole, UL489/CSA 22.2 no. 5.1

→Page 17/80
